Awesome Home and Location
Guest: Terri (Richmond, VA)| 08/14/14
Best vacation ever! We were three couples and two individuals staying in this luxurious 5 bedroom, 5 bath home right on the beach. We never felt overcrowded, even with all eight of us in the common area (although 6 in the plunge pool got a little cozy). The house had all the modern conveniences of home (including satellite TV and Wifi service) with a full kitchen with dishwasher and a laundry room (so you can pack lighter and just run a load of wash mid-week). The best part is the location, right on the beach with a private dock 20 feet from the back door. The reef and the breaking waves are about 200 yards offshore, and you can use the provided snorkeling equipment and kayaks to go out and see the beautiful corals and tropical fish. The back deck and the plunge pool make a nice place to end the day watching the sun set over the Caribbean Sea. In the morning they make a nice place to sit and listen as the island comes to life with kids going to school and fishermen boating along the reef, and all were quick with a hello and a wave. Pirates View is within a quick taxi ride of West End and Anthony’s Key for the shoping, bars and restaurants (You can walk to Anthony’s Key, but the cab ride is easier and safer considering there are no sidewalks along the road). West Bay is a slightly longer cab ride (around 10 minutes), but has more of the “resort beach” atmosphere with shops offering paddle boarding, parasailing and wind surfing along the pristine white sand.

A Jewel on Sandy Bay
Guest: Susan R. | 04/11/14
I stayed here with a group of family members who were in Roatan for a wedding. The wedding was held at one of the big resorts on West Bay, but we chose to stay in Sandy Bay to be away from the crowds, and to have kitchen facilities to prepare our own food. The house is very comfortable and well equipped, and is designed with high end floors and countertops. The beds are comfortable, the air conditioners work well, and there is a good supply of clean water and ice. We made good use of the kayaks and snorkeling gear. We had 2 rental vehicles, one a 4WD pickup truck, and could not fit them both in the parking area inside the gate. It is possible to take a 4WD vehicle around back on the beach and park there, which we did. I would not recommend staying here without a car.
We prepared our own food and ate out only a couple of times. The wedding party that stayed at the West Bay resort almost all got sick with foodborne illness. Those of us who stayed at the house did not. We shopped at Plaza Mar, which is near the Eldon's grocery in Coxen Hole but has lower prices. We bought seafood at the Hybur Seafood market in French Harbour. The seafood is frozen, but reasonably priced and good quality.
We very much enjoyed a day excursion to Pigeon Key with Mango Creek Resort, and diving with West End Divers. Sandy Bay is convenient located between Coxen Hole, for shopping, and West End/West Bay for other attractions.
Overall, if you stay at Pirates View. You won't be disappointed.
